NBCU Says Super Bowl 2026 Commercials Have Sold Out at $7 Million Per Spot

Posted on September 4, 2025September 4, 2025 by Santiago Leon

NBCUniversal has officially sold out all commercial inventory for Super Bowl LX, set for February 8, 2026, in Santa Clara, California. The company confirmed that every 30-second ad slot has been purchased, with prices starting at $7 million per spot.
